Cristian Chivu is preparing to rotate his goalkeepers again, with Josep Martinez set to start for Inter against Torino in the Coppa Italia.
The plan reflects the coach’s intention to manage his options between the posts.
According to Corriere dello Sport, Yann Sommer has regained confidence after his recent response performances.
Following a difficult outing against Pisa, the decision to stick with the Swiss goalkeeper has paid off.
His key intervention against Borussia Dortmund drew comparisons with an earlier decisive save in Amsterdam, which also helped him rediscover rhythm and assurance.

Sommer is expected to remain in goal for the upcoming Serie A match against Cremonese, a fixture Chivu has described as hugely important.
However, the rotation policy will resume shortly after.
The Coppa Italia tie with Torino next week should mark Martinez’s return to action.
The Spanish goalkeeper has fully recovered from his ankle issue and is now ready to make his first appearance of 2026.
Chivu reportedly wants to give Martinez continuity as well.
If he performs well, further opportunities could follow, including a possible start against Sassuolo.
The staff view this period as crucial in evaluating the depth and reliability of the squad across all competitions.
